I share about the “unconditional love” I discovered at the bottom of my grief- When nothing outside of me could help, not even the faith I longed to lean on as the presence of God. I knew I had to face the pain fully, and the pain itself became the medicine. At the bottom of my grief, I found something profound-a deep love and grace alive within me, a strength of unconditional love that could carry my sorrow, where grief and love could coexist, not replace each other. This is where I felt my son’s presence beyond the body, beyond the mind, and discovered that love and connection are always waiting, even in the darkest moments.
I am deeply grateful for Grace and do not understand its mystery, yet I fully embrace it. 💛🙏
